We are from the Sustainable Development Team Session 2010 – 11 of HKU Engineering Alumni Association (HKUEAA). Sustainable Development is a current hot topic in every discipline in particular engineering. In the past few years, HKUEAA has been promoting sustainable development (SD) in the society by having experiential projects for HKU engineering alumni and students to appreciate the examples of SD outside Hong Kong and to help develop SD ideas in the context of Hong Kong.
This year our theme is Eco-city, a way-out to a sustainable tomorrow (環保之城,邁向可持續明天的出路). An overseas study tour to South Korea, will be held during 26/5 – 28/5 (Thur – Sat) this year. We would like to invite applications for our study tour. Details are as follows:

We aim to appreciate real examples of sustainable city development by visiting theme spots including Cheong Gye Cheon Museum (清溪川文化館), Seoul Digital Media City (DMC), SUDOKWON Landfill site Management Corporation (SLC). At the same time, we will also visit the Korea University and have cultural exchange with the host.
